BASKETBALL CLUB

A large number of basketball enthusiasts gathered in the council chambers on Monday evening to discuss the future of basketball in Shannon. Miss R. Haley occupied the chair. In the absence of Miss J. Clough, the secretary, the minutes of the 1945 meeting were read by Mrs. D. Gyae, who reported that the club's banking account showed a credit balance. It was decided to open the club again this year on a date to be arranged later. . Two "A" grade teams and a "B" grade team are to 'be entered in the Horowhenua competitions. The following were elected offi--cers for the coming season: — Secretary: Miss P. Small; treasurer: Miss H. Gardner; committee: Mrs. Mortimer, Misses J. Pigott, M. Jameson, J. Parr, R. Haley, P. Gunning and A. Pedersen; delegates to the Horowhenua Basketball Association: Mrs. Gyde, Misses A. Pedersen, M. Jameson and J. Pigott. A working bee was arranged for Saturday, March 30, to prepare thecourts for play. It was decided to hold a dance during April to assist the club in raising funds.
